Finding "Duplicates Through Time": How I Cleaned Up 300GB of Photos Without Losing Quality

Lately, I have been playing around with my personal photo and video library (around 300GB of files, spanning 10+ years of memories). I had a specific type of problem: I needed to save space on my SSD, but I did not want to pay any third-party cloud provider for extra storage.

To make things trickier, I was traveling in a remote location without any electronics stores nearby. Buying an external hard drive was out of the question. I had my laptop, tablet, and smartphone. Together, they had enough cumulative storage, but my laptop drive was suffocating.

What if I just made the library smaller?
